Verian works with clients around the world, providing rigorous evidence, insights and advisory services to inspire the next generation of public policy and programmes.
In Aotearoa, Verian (formerly Kantar Public and Colmar Brunton) is the leading research-based evidence and advisory business focused solely on the public sector. We provide government agencies with solutions to some of New Zealand’s trickiest questions. Learn more about us at https://www.veriangroup.com/nz
This role will be responsible for:
- General office management for two locations (Wellington and Auckland), coordination of day-to-day office tasks including ordering supplies, and managing and tracking IT equipment.
- Finance and project administration: tasks such as setting up purchase orders, liaising between the finance team and vendors to resolve queries, company credit card tracking, new vendor set ups, ordering and dispatch of incentives, and monitoring invoices.
- People and event management; contributing to HR activities including onboarding and offboarding, employee engagement initiatives and assisting with both internal and external events including venue and accommodation booking, flights and travel.
- IT Liaison: You will be the point of escalation between the employees and IT services to ensure quick and effective resolution.
- Qualitative team support: You will carry out a range of tasks including ordering incentives, preparing fieldwork stimulus materials, and booking venues.
